Transaction 93e95e64f160a55989f3e8dc5acfd930698a283d728359bd6255aba800f92ba6

1 Input
1 Outputs
  • 93e95e64f160a55989f3e8dc5acfd930698a283d728359bd6255aba800f92ba6:0
  • value  1384080
    address  3P6TiczUsqyzXvTiMUcEQTd4xiZHJaSc82